However, some prefer to write temperatures with a space. For instance, the Chicago Manual of Style and the APA Style Guide differ on this point: Chicago Style: The temperature will reach 120°C. APA Style: The temperature will reach 120 °C. If you’re not using a specific style guide, either approach is acceptable.MLA General Format. The Chicago Manual of Style offers two very different methods of citation: (1) notes-bibliography and (2) author-date. The first method uses footnotes or endnotes to place citations at the bottom of a page or at the end of a paper; these notes refer to the sources that are further detailed in the paper’s final ...Feb 11, 2021 · How do you format an abstract in Chicago style? In Chicago style, an abstract comes after the title page and the copyright page. This means that it should be labeled as page iii of your text. It comes right before your table of contents. All the pages of your abstract should be numbered, but an abstract generally should not exceed one page.

Citing books in Chicago author-date style In author-date style , books are cited with brief in-text citations corresponding to entries in a reference list. A reference list looks the same as a bibliography, except that the year is placed directly after the author’s name.Chicago style is a set of formatting and citation guidelines that tell you how an academic paper should look, similar to other styles like APA or MLA.
